Deck 17: Angiography and Interventional Procedures
1
Which of the following vessel(s)do/does NOT supply blood to the brain?

A) Right common carotid artery
B) Left common carotid artery
C) Vertebral arteries
D) Subclavian arteries
Subclavian arteries
2
Which veins drain blood from the scalp and facial region?

A) Internal jugular veins
B) Vertebral veins
C) Brachiocephalic veins
D) External jugular veins
External jugular veins
3
Which vessel in the brain supplies blood primarily to the anterior portion of the brain?

A) Basilar artery
B) External carotid artery
C) Internal carotid artery
D) Vertebral arteries
Internal carotid artery
